Compare 18/15 and 14/8

1st number: 1 3/15, 2nd number: 1 6/8

18/15 is smaller than 14/8

Steps for comparing fractions

  1.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
    LCM of 15 and 8 is 120

    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 120
  2. For the 1st fraction, since 15 × 8 = 120,
    18/15 = 18 × 8/15 × 8 = 144/120
  3.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 15 = 120,
    14/8 = 14 × 15/8 × 15 = 210/120
  4.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
  5. 144/120 < 210/120 or 18/15 < 14/8
